Identifies the CICS system to which this display line refers. *LOC means local CICS or TOR.
Identifies the sequence number of the MUF relative to the position of the associated DBCSID macro appended to the DBCVTPR macro.
Indicates the total of tasks currently waiting for CA Datacom/DB I/O to complete.
Indicates the current number of tasks which have acquired exclusive control by issuing update requests to CA Datacom/DB.
Indicates the current number of tasks waiting for access to CA Datacom/DB. If this is not zero (000), the maximum number of concurrent users has been reached. The maximum number of concurrent users is defined in the DBCVTPR macro as described in the System Reference Guide.
Indicates the total number of CA Datacom/DB requests issued since CA Datacom CICS Services initiation, or since a DBOC RESET=STATS transaction was issued.
Indicates the total number of requests which had to wait for CA Datacom/DB access since the initiation of CA Datacom CICS Services or since a DBOC RESET=STATS transaction was issued.
Indicates the total number of requests receiving CA Datacom/DB service after an I/O wait.
Indicates the total number of requests receiving CA Datacom/DB. service without an I/O wait.
Indicates the total number of start I/Os issued by CA Datacom/DB.
Indicates the average number of start I/Os issued by CA Datacom/DB per request.
